Vandals completely destroyed children’s play equipment by setting fire to “For Sale” signs they had placed in a large rope swing.
Some £3,000 worth of damage was caused to the Twelve Acres play area in the Marks Farm estate in Braintree last Friday after arsonists targeted a swing basket.
The basket was totally burnt out and the fire also damaged the safety surfacing below the swing, which was only installed last month at a cost of £3,483 to Braintree Council.
The steel swing frame was not affected by the fire.
